Description

Bring a piece of cinematic history right to your desk with this highly detailed, pocket-sized T-800 Endoskeleton Bust inspired by Terminator 2: Judgment Day. Scaled precisely to stand at a compact 7 cm (approx. 2.75 inches) tall, this miniature replica is the perfect weekend print for sci-fi fans, pop culture collectors, and 3D printing enthusiasts alike.

Despite its small scale, the model retains all the iconic features of the classic Cyberdyne Systems model, including the intricate hydraulic neck wiring, teeth grills, and the classic "T2" logo emblazoned right on the display base.

🖨️ Printing & Design Features

  • Optimized for FDM Printing: Specifically designed to look incredible when printed with standard PLA filaments (especially silk silver or matte grey).
  • Visible Horizontal Layer Lines: The model embraces the 3D-printing aesthetic; standard layer heights (0.12mm - 0.16mm) beautifully accentuate the mechanical contours of the skull, giving it a unique "machined prototype" look.
  • Hand-Painted Details: For the ultimate movie-accurate finish, the eyes are designed to look flat/painted rather than glowing or housing LEDs, making it a straightforward post-processing job with a bit of red acrylic paint.

⚙️ Recommended Print Settings

To capture the fine details at this 7cm scale, we recommend the following slicer settings:

  • Layer Height: 0.12mm (Optimal for fine mechanical detail) or 0.16mm.
  • Infill: 15% - 20% (Gyroiod recommended for stability).
  • Supports: Yes, tree/organic supports are recommended for the jaw overhang and the rear neck hydraulics.
  • Outer Wall Speed: Slow down slightly (approx. 40-60 mm/s) to ensure the facial features print flawlessly.
  • Filament Suggestion: Silk Silver PLA, Brushed Metal PLA, or Matte Grey.

🎨 Post-Processing Tips

For the look shown in the preview:

  1. Print the main body in silver or grey filament.
  2. Use a fine-tip brush with matte red acrylic paint to carefully fill in the circular eye sockets.
  3. Use a contrasting color (like dark red or black filling) to make the "T2" logo on the base pop!
